How they compare

United States currently reports 4,520 terawatt-hours against 1,193 terawatt-hours in Russia, a difference of 3,327 terawatt-hours.

That makes United States's figure about 3.8 times Russia's.

Across all 41 years both countries report, United States has been ahead every year.

Russia ranks 4th and United States ranks 2nd of 214 countries.

United States has averaged higher in every one of the 5 decades both report.

Head to head by decade

Decade Russia United States Difference Ahead
1980s 1,031 terawatt-hours 2,835 terawatt-hours 1,805 terawatt-hours United States
1990s 920.6 terawatt-hours 3,539 terawatt-hours 2,618 terawatt-hours United States
2000s 950.65 terawatt-hours 3,947 terawatt-hours 2,996 terawatt-hours United States
2010s 1,076 terawatt-hours 4,098 terawatt-hours 3,022 terawatt-hours United States
2020s 1,165 terawatt-hours 4,275 terawatt-hours 3,110 terawatt-hours United States

Averages of every year both report within each decade.
